Gambling Age to be Raised in Macau
Macau is planning to raise from 18 to 21 the minimum age at which a person can legally gamble, chief executive Edmund Ho Hau-wah told lawmakers yesterday.

Pinnacle Entertainment Implodes Sands Casino Hotel in Atlantic City, N.J.Pinnacle Entertainment last night cleared the way for its planned multi-billion-dollar gaming resort at the heart of the famed Boardwalk with a spectacular implosion of the former Sands Casino Hotel. The nitroglycerin- fueled blast marked the first nighttime implosion in New Jersey and first-ever casino-hotel implosion on the East Coast.
